Types of Jackpots
Admiral X live dealer offers several kinds of jackpots, varying from a couple thousand to many million dollars:

- Fixed Jackpot: This has a set amount that does not change regardless of the total wagers. To win, a specific condition must be met, such as achieving a certain combination on a slot game.
- Progressive Jackpot: The most famous and commonly recognized type. Its size grows constantly based on the total bets made by players. If no one wins, it keeps accumulating according to certain conditions. Once a jackpot is won, it drops to a minimum level. This type offers the largest potential wins.
- Entry Jackpot: A set amount randomly distributed among a group of players. It is given to a winner at the conclusion of the draw.
- Mystery Jackpot: The prize value is a secret. Limits are established for the pool. When it reaches a specific amount, a draw takes place with no specific conditions required.
- Double Bonus: This provides an extra reward for the game. The likelihood of winning depends on the bet size. The prize amount and winning criteria are unknown.
Ways to Take Part in a Jackpot Draw
The progressive jackpot, which expands with each non-winning draw, is the most attractive. A fraction of every wager goes towards increasing this amount, which can surpass several million dollars. There are three main methods for forming the prize pool:
- Single Slot Progression: A percentage of every bet on one particular slot machine boosts the jackpot. These don't reach large amounts but are easier to win.
- Casino-Wide Contribution: The jackpot grows with bets from all players using casino slot machines, leading to substantial growth.
- Networked Casinos: The largest jackpots come from a collection of bets collected across a network of participating casinos.

Pay-Outs for Progressive Jackpots
Before entering a jackpot contest, it’s crucial to examine the payout terms. Some casinos restrict monthly payouts. For example, if the limit is $1,000 and the win is $100,000, it could require more than 8 years to get the total prize, which is undesirable for many. Additionally, many casinos might shut down before the payout is complete. Thus, it’s essential that the payout policy specifies no restrictions on progressive payouts.
